28 #include <sys/cdefs.h>
29 __RCSID("$NetBSD: t_condwait.c,v 1.2 2013/03/29 02:32:38 christos Exp $");
30 
31 #include <errno.h>
32 #include <pthread.h>
33 #include <stdio.h>
34 #include <stdlib.h>
35 #include <string.h>
36 #include <time.h>
37 #include <unistd.h>
38 
39 #include <atf-c.h>
40 
41 #define WAITTIME 2	/* Timeout wait secound */
42 
43 static const int debug = 1;
44 
45 static void *
46 run(void *param)
47 {
48 	struct timespec ts, to, te;
49 	clockid_t clck;
50 	pthread_condattr_t attr;
51 	pthread_cond_t cond;
52 	pthread_mutex_t m = PTHREAD_MUTEX_INITIALIZER;
53 	int ret = 0;
54 
55 
56 	clck = *(clockid_t *)param;
57 	pthread_condattr_init(&attr);
58 	pthread_condattr_setclock(&attr, clck); /* MONOTONIC or MONOTONIC */
59 	pthread_cond_init(&cond, &attr);
60 
61 	ATF_REQUIRE_EQ((ret = pthread_mutex_lock(&m)), 0);
62 
63 	ATF_REQUIRE_EQ(clock_gettime(clck, &ts), 0);
64 	to = ts;
65 
66 	if (debug)
67 		printf("started: %lld.%09ld sec\n", (long long)to.tv_sec,
68 		    to.tv_nsec);
69 
70 	ts.tv_sec += WAITTIME;	/* Timeout wait */
71 
72 	switch (ret = pthread_cond_timedwait(&cond, &m, &ts)) {
73 	case ETIMEDOUT:
74 		/* Timeout */
75 		ATF_REQUIRE_EQ(clock_gettime(clck, &te), 0);
76 		timespecsub(&te, &to, &to);
77 		if (debug) {
78 			printf("timeout: %lld.%09ld sec\n",
79 			    (long long)te.tv_sec, te.tv_nsec);
80 			printf("elapsed: %lld.%09ld sec\n",
81 			    (long long)to.tv_sec, to.tv_nsec);
82 		}
83 		ATF_REQUIRE_EQ(to.tv_sec, WAITTIME);
84 		break;
85 	default:
86 		ATF_REQUIRE_MSG(0, "pthread_cond_timedwait: %s", strerror(ret));
87 	}
88 
89 	ATF_REQUIRE_MSG(!(ret = pthread_mutex_unlock(&m)),
90 	    "pthread_mutex_unlock: %s", strerror(ret));
91 	pthread_exit(&ret);
92 }
93 
94 static void
95 cond_wait(clockid_t clck, const char *msg) {
96 	pthread_t child;
97 
98 	if (debug)
99 		printf( "**** %s clock wait starting\n", msg);
100 	ATF_REQUIRE_EQ(pthread_create(&child, NULL, run, &clck), 0);
101 	ATF_REQUIRE_EQ(pthread_join(child, NULL), 0); /* wait for terminate */
102 	if (debug)
103 		printf( "**** %s clock wait ended\n", msg);
104 }
105 
106 ATF_TC(cond_wait_real);
107 ATF_TC_HEAD(cond_wait_real, tc)
108 {
109 	atf_tc_set_md_var(tc, "descr", "Checks pthread_cond_timedwait "
110 	    "with CLOCK_REALTIME");
111 }
112 
113 ATF_TC_BODY(cond_wait_real, tc) {
114 	cond_wait(CLOCK_REALTIME, "CLOCK_REALTIME");
115 }
116 
117 ATF_TC(cond_wait_mono);
118 ATF_TC_HEAD(cond_wait_mono, tc)
119 {
120 	atf_tc_set_md_var(tc, "descr", "Checks pthread_cond_timedwait "
121 	    "with CLOCK_MONOTONIC");
122 }
123 
124 ATF_TC_BODY(cond_wait_mono, tc) {
125 	cond_wait(CLOCK_MONOTONIC, "CLOCK_MONOTONIC");
126 }
127 
128 ATF_TP_ADD_TCS(tp)
129 {
130 	ATF_TP_ADD_TC(tp, cond_wait_real);
131 	ATF_TP_ADD_TC(tp, cond_wait_mono);
132 	return 0;
133 }
